Post by Ldi-Ovef Te_Azi on Jul 19, 2006 12:39:46 GMT -5
even though anakin's clothing looked black, it was dark brown. we cant do black here, and i think its for a couple of reasons.
-there were few actual jedi with black, but all sith had black -people in the world view jedi in earthen colors, not black, so they would not think of you as a jedi in a charity or convention setting, they would think you to be sith.

Post by Jedimom/Cor-Al Gelkar on Jul 19, 2006 13:29:29 GMT -5
Now that COSI has the actual tunic worn by Hayden and I've personally seen it, I can vouch that neither the tabbards nor the fabric are black. Everything is indeed very dark brown. There is no black in his costume at all

Post by Jauhzmynn Enz on Jul 19, 2006 13:51:17 GMT -5
You'er right An'Jol,I don't think any Old Republic Jedi wore black. Luminara's clothing appears to be a very deep brown, or purple, maybe a dark shade of eggplant. Barris' could be the same shade or even a navy. There's very few pictures of them in sunlight, unfortuantly with the set and promo lights navy, eggplant, and dark brown appears black.:/ Not even Dooku's clothing is black, but a very dark brown.

Post by Ani-Chay Pinn on Jul 19, 2006 22:46:19 GMT -5
From the reference images on the Padawan's Guide page, Luminara's robes are definitely dark brown. It really shows up in the pictures in the Dressing A Galaxy book, too. But Bariss's costume is as close to black (or eggplant) as I've seen on any Jedi, though her belt is dark brown. I never looked closely enough before now, but you're right, Dooku's clothes are very dark brown.
